MEASUREMENT OF HBA1C IN GINGIVAL CREVICULAR BLOOD USING A HIGH PRESSURE LIQUID CHROMATOGRAPHY PROCEDURE

Course overview
Intended audience: Clinical Laboratory Scientists, laboratory directors, Pathologists Keywords: HbA1c, gingival crevicular blood, high pressure liquid chromatography, screening for diabetes Educational objectives: Upon completion of this activity, you will be able to define the acceptable performance between HbA1c results, understand the stability of HbA1c in blood, and that HbA1c levels from gingival crevicular blood can be used to screen dental patients for diabetes.
